Small Kitchen Remodeling in Cincinnati, OH
Small kitchen remodeling services focus on updating and enhancing the functionality, appearance, and layout of existing kitchens. These projects typically include tasks such as replacing cabinets, upgrading countertops, installing new appliances, updating lighting fixtures, and refreshing paint or backsplashes. Property owners often seek these services to improve the overall look of their kitchen, increase storage space, or make the area more efficient without undertaking a full-scale renovation.
Before requesting small kitchen remodeling,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of materials and finishes available, and how the changes will impact the existing layout. It’s also helpful to consider budget options, timeline expectations, and any specific style preferences. Clarifying these details can ensure the project aligns with personal needs and property goals, resulting in a more satisfying upgrade.

Small Kitchen Remodeling Questions
What are common small kitchen remodeling projects? Typical projects include updating cabinets, installing new countertops, upgrading lighting, and replacing hardware to improve functionality and appearance.
Can small kitchen remodels improve storage space? Yes, incorporating custom cabinetry, shelves, and organizers can maximize storage in limited kitchen areas.
Is it possible to update a kitchen without a full renovation? Absolutely, small updates like new backsplashes, fixtures, or paint can refresh the space without extensive work.
What should homeowners consider before starting a small kitchen remodel? Consider the existing layout, desired features, and budget to plan a practical and efficient update.
